Understanding Stiffness and Its Causes

As a local chiropractor, I often see patients who describe stiffness as an overwhelming burden that restricts their movement and overall comfort.

It’s important to understand that stiffness can arise from a variety of factors, each contributing to that uneasy feeling in your body. One of the most common culprits is muscle tension.

This tension can develop from poor posture or sitting for extended periods—like when you’re at your desk or hunched over your phone. These habits can lead to tight muscles, making it difficult to move freely and comfortably.

In addition, injuries often trigger stiffness. When you sustain an injury, your body instinctively tightens the muscles around the affected area to provide protection, which can lead to discomfort.

Age is another factor to consider; as we grow older, our joints may naturally lose flexibility, which can contribute to persistent stiffness.

Interestingly, stress can also play a significant role in how your body feels. When you’re stressed, your body may respond by tensing up your muscles.

Recognizing these various causes of stiffness is crucial for understanding your own body. By identifying what might be causing your discomfort, you can take proactive steps to alleviate it.

Stretch 1: Cat-Cow Stretch

As a local chiropractor, I often recommend the Cat-Cow Stretch to my patients as a simple yet effective way to alleviate back stiffness and enhance flexibility. This stretch involves two dynamic movements that work to engage and mobilize your spine, which is crucial for maintaining a healthy back.

To begin, position yourself on all fours, ensuring your hands are directly beneath your shoulders and your knees are aligned under your hips. As you take a deep breath in, arch your back while lifting your head and tailbone toward the ceiling—this is known as the “cow” position. Hold this posture for a moment, feeling the gentle extension in your spine.

Next, as you exhale, round your spine by tucking your chin toward your chest and drawing your belly button in towards your spine—this is the “cat” position. Transition smoothly between these two positions, repeating the cycle for 5 to 10 breaths.

You’ll likely find that this stretch not only helps to relieve tension in your back but also promotes greater spinal flexibility, which is essential for overall health.

Stretch 2: Child’s Pose

As a local chiropractor, I often see patients dealing with stiffness and tension in their bodies. If you’ve experienced the benefits of the Cat-Cow Stretch, I encourage you to explore another effective pose that can contribute to your overall well-being: the Child’s Pose.

This gentle stretch isn’t only beneficial for relieving physical stiffness but also offers mental relaxation.

Here’s how to properly perform Child’s Pose:

  1. Begin by kneeling on the floor and gently sitting back on your heels.
  2. Extend your arms forward and lower your torso towards the ground.
  3. Allow your forehead to rest on the mat, which helps your shoulders to relax.
  4. Focus on taking deep, calming breaths as you feel the stretch in your back and hips.
  5. Hold this position for at least 30 seconds or longer if it feels comfortable for you.

Incorporating Child’s Pose into your daily routine can significantly help ease tension in your lower back and neck, promoting a sense of tranquility and relaxation.

Stretch 3: Torso Twist

As a local chiropractor, I often emphasize the importance of maintaining flexibility and mobility in your spine for overall health. One effective stretch I recommend is the Torso Twist, which can significantly alleviate stiffness in your back and enhance spinal flexibility.

To perform the Torso Twist, find a comfortable seated position—either with your legs crossed or extended in front of you. Begin by placing your right hand on your left knee and your left hand behind you for support. As you take a deep breath in, focus on lengthening your spine. When you exhale, gently twist your torso to the left, allowing your gaze to follow over your shoulder. Hold this position for 15-30 seconds, and pay attention to the sensations in your back and sides as you stretch.

Afterward, return to your starting position and switch sides, placing your left hand on your right knee. Repeat the twist, holding for the same amount of time.

Incorporating the Torso Twist into your daily routine can significantly improve your spinal mobility, reduce tension, and promote better posture. Stretch 4: Hip Flexor Stretch

As a local chiropractor dedicated to promoting natural healing and overall wellness, I want to share with you the benefits of incorporating the Hip Flexor Stretch into your daily routine.

Many people experience tightness in their hips and lower back, often due to prolonged periods of sitting or engaging in intense physical activity. This stretch specifically targets the hip flexors, which can become tight and contribute to discomfort.

Here’s how you can perform this stretch effectively:

  1. Begin by positioning yourself in a lunge stance, with one foot forward and the opposite knee resting on the ground.
  2. Ensure that your torso remains upright, and gently push your hips forward. This motion helps to isolate the hip flexor muscles.
  3. You should feel a comforting stretch in the front of the hip on the side where your knee is on the ground.
  4. Hold this position for 20-30 seconds, and remember to breathe deeply to enhance relaxation.
  5. Afterward, switch sides and repeat the stretch to maintain balance in both hips.

Incorporating this simple yet effective stretch into your routine can significantly aid in alleviating tension and improving your overall mobility.

Stretch 5: Standing Forward Bend

As a local chiropractor, I often see patients struggling with tight hips and lower back discomfort. One effective stretch I recommend is the Standing Forward Bend. This simple yet powerful stretch can significantly alleviate tension in your lower back, hamstrings, and calves, making it a wonderful addition to your daily routine.

To perform the Standing Forward Bend, begin by standing tall with your feet hip-width apart. Take a deep breath in and raise your arms overhead. As you exhale, hinge at your hips and gently fold forward. It’s important to listen to your body; if you feel any strain in your lower back, keep your knees slightly bent to avoid discomfort.

Allow your head and neck to relax, allowing them to hang heavy toward the floor. You can grab your elbows for an added stretch or simply let your hands rest on the ground. Hold this position for 20 to 30 seconds, focusing on your breath.

With regular practice, you’ll likely notice improved flexibility and a reduction in stiffness. Incorporating the Standing Forward Bend into your routine can greatly enhance your overall mobility and comfort.

Stretch 6: Seated Spinal Twist

As a local chiropractor, I often emphasize the importance of stretching for relieving tension and enhancing flexibility in the spine. One of my favorite stretches to recommend is the Seated Spinal Twist. This simple yet effective stretch not only improves spinal mobility but also supports digestion and can help alleviate lower back pain, which many of my patients experience.

Here’s how to perform the Seated Spinal Twist:

  1. Begin by sitting comfortably on the floor with your legs extended in front of you.
  2. Bend your right knee and place your foot outside of your left thigh.
  3. Inhale deeply, focusing on lengthening your spine, and as you exhale, gently twist your torso to the right.
  4. For a deeper stretch, you can use your left arm to gently press against your right knee.
  5. Hold this position for 15-30 seconds, allowing your body to relax into the stretch, and then switch sides.

Incorporating the Seated Spinal Twist into your daily routine can significantly enhance your posture and reduce stiffness. This stretch is a valuable addition to your self-care practices, especially if you’re new to chiropractic care and natural healing.
